Today marks 15 years since Guy Goma was accidentally interviewed on BBC News.The computer technician had been visiting the corporation for a job interview, however, in the mother of all mix-ups, he ended up being grilled on live TV after being mistaken for technology expert Guy Kewney.Goma expertly managed the nightmare situation and when he realised he’d been brought in to comment on technology Apple Computer’s court case with the Beatles’ record label, Apple Corps, he attempted to answer the questions thrown at him.His face upon realising he was on TV is one we’ll never forget.But how did the whole shenanigan actually happen?Goma had been waiting in the main reception area of the BBC Television Centre to be interviewed for a job as an.
